全国服务热线 15221406036

菏泽西门子S7-200代理商

发布:2023-07-19 17:07,更新:2024-05-08 07:10

菏泽西门子S7-200代理商

系列PLC适用于各行各业,各种场合中的检测、监测及控制的自动化。S7-200系列的强大功能使其无论在独立运行中,或相连成网络皆能实现复杂控制功能。因此S7-200系列具有*的性能/价格比。

6ES7214-1BD23-0XB8性能参数:

具有14输入点和10个输出点,数字量。

输出类型:继电器。

可连续扩展模块大数量:7个(168点)

通讯接口:1个RS-485

编程电缆:6ES7901-3CB30-0XA0(PC/PPI电缆)

6ES7901-3DB30-0XA0(PCUSB[1]至CPU)

CPU单元设计

--集成的24V负载电源:可直接连接到传感器和变送器(执行器),CPU224输出280,400mA。可用作负载电源。

不同的设备类型

--CPU224各有2种类型CPU,具有不同的电源电压和控制电压。

中断输入

--允许以极快的速度对过程信号的上升沿作出响应。

高速计数器

--CPU224

--6个高速计数器(30KHz),具有CPU221/222相同的功能。

CPU224

--可方便地用数字量和模拟量扩展模块进行扩展。可使用仿真器(选件)对本机输入信号进行仿真,用于调试用户程序。

模拟电位器

--CPU224还具有脉冲输出

--2路高频率脉冲输出(大20KHz),用于控制步进电机或伺服电机实现定位任务。

实时时钟

--例如为信息加注时间标记,记录机器运行时间或对过程进行时间控制。

EEPROM存储器模块(选件)

--可作为修改与拷贝程序的快速工具(无需编程器),并可进行辅助软件归档工作。

电池模块

--用于长时间数据后备。用户数据(如标志位状态,数据块,定时器,计数器)可通过内部的超级电容存贮大约5天。选用电池模块能延长存贮时间到200天(10年寿命)。电池模块插在存储器模块的卡槽中

PWM向导移植

在S7-200 SMART 中重新调用向导生成的 PWMx_RUN 子程序,如图2所示:

PWM_2

图2. PWMx_RUN子程序移植

PWM 指令移植

S7-200 与 S7-200 SMART 使用PLS指令控制脉宽调制(PWM)的SM 定义不同,如表1所示,不能将 S7-200 CPU 编写的 PLS指令程序直接用于S7-200 SMART。

表1.S7-200 与 S7-200 SMART 的SM 对比

 

Q0.0S7-200S7-200 SMART
SM67.0PWM更新周期PWM更新周期
SM67.1PWM更新脉宽PWM更新脉宽
SM67.2未使用未使用
SM67.3PWM时间基准:0=1μs,1=1msPWM时间基准:0=1μs,1=1ms
SM67.4PWM更新:0=异步,1=同步未使用
SM67.5未使用未使用
SM67.6PTO/PWM模式选择:0=PTO,1=PWMPTO/PWM模式选择:0=PWM,1=PTO
SM67.7PWM启用:0=禁止,1=启用PWM启用:0=禁止,1=启用

 

S7-200 SMART 只能使用同步更新更改 PWM 波形的特性。

使用 STEP 7 Micro/Win SMART 打开S7-200 CPU 的 PLS 指令程序需修改控制字SM67.6,如图3所示:


PLC 硬件系统设计

1 . PLC 型号的选择

在作出系统控制方案的决策之前,要详细了解被控对象的控制要求,从而决定是否选用 PLC 进行控制。

在控制系统逻辑关系较复杂(需要大量中间继电器、时间继电器、计数器等)、工艺流程和产品改型较频繁、需要进行数据处理和信息管理(有数据运算、模拟量的控制、 PID 调节等)、系统要求有较高的可靠性和稳定性、准备实现工厂自动化联网等情况下,使用 PLC 控制是很必要的。

目前,国内外众多的生产厂家提供了多种系列功能各异的 PLC 产品,使用户眼花缭乱、无所适从。所以全面权衡利弊、合理地选择机型才能达到经济实用的目的。一般选择机型要以满足系统功能需要为宗旨,不要盲目贪大求全,以免造成投资和设备资源的浪费。机型的选择可从以下几个方面来考虑。

( 1 )对输入 / 输出点的选择

盲目选择点数多的机型会造成一定浪费。

要先弄清除控制系统的 I/O 总点数,再按实际所需总点数的 15 ~ 20 %留出备用量(为系统的改造等留

西门子PLC模块6ES7215-1AG40-0XB0

插入一个400H站

2.点中SIMATIC H Station(1) 后,双击右侧“Hardware"组态硬件进入HW Config编辑器。
►在组态中添加两个UR2-H的机架,添加路径为:SIMATIC 400 > RACK-400 > UR2-H(6ES7 400-2JA00-0AA0)
►分别在两个机架中添加PS407电源模块,路径为:SIMATIC 400 > PS-400 > PS 407 10A(6ES7 407-0KR02-0AA0)


图4 在硬件组态中为400H站添加机架和电源模块

►分别在两个机架中添加CPU单元,添加路径为:SIMATIC 400 > CPU 400 > CPU 400-H > CPU 414-4H > 6ES7 414-4HJ04-0AB0 > V4.0,在添加CPU的过程中,需要为CPU上集成的DP接口设置地址并且创建所归属的Profibus DP总线,如下图所示:


图5 创建Profibus DP网络

为CPU 414-4H CPU添加同步模块(所选择同步模块的距离类型要保持*),如下图所示:


图6 添加同步模块

同理,以一样的方式为Rack1添加CPU。
►分别在两个机架中添加CP443-1以太网通讯模块,路径:SIMATIC 400 > CP-400 > Industrial Ethernet > CP 443-1 > 6GK7 443-1EX11-0XE0 > V2.6;
为CP 443-1设置参数,创建并选择“Ethernet(1)";
勾选“Set MAC address/use ISO protocol",并且为该网卡设置MAC地址(网卡出厂预设MAC地址可以在CP网卡上看到),同时取消选择“IP protocol is being used"项。如图7所示:


图7  CP443-1修改MAC参数

以同样的方式,为Rack 1添加CP443-1并设置 MAC地址,选择子网“Ethernet(1)"。


图8 硬件组态结束后的结构

利用以上步骤就完成了硬件的组态,或者也可以先组态好Rack0及所需插入的所有模块,然后将其拷贝,生成Rack1及其所需插入的所有模块,在此操作中请注意修改新生成的Profibus网络参数以及Ethernet网络参数,设置方法请参考前文叙述。

2.3添加必要的OB组织块程序
以下*B块必须装入S7-400H 的CPU 中:OB70、OB72、OB80、OB82、OB83、OB85、OB86、OB87、OB88、OB121和OB 122;如果没有装载这些OB,H系统在出现错误时可能会进入STOP 状态。可以根据需要在这些OB中编写程序读取系统诊断信息。
在插入方式上,可以在Block目录下面通过右键选择“Insert New Object" > “Organization Block",插入所期望的组织块,此处如果没有特殊需求的话,可以不对插入的组织块进行编程,插入空的OB即可。

2.4 硬件和程序的下装
为了实现Step 7与 CPU的通讯,首先要确保CP443-1与安装了Step 7的电脑之间的物理连接。
打开“SIAMATIC Manager" > “Options" > “Set PG/PC Interface…"可以将PG/PC接口设置成ISO Ind Ethernet 方式。如果使用的电脑安装了1613网卡,可以将PG/PC接口设置为1613的ISO通讯方式,如果使用的电脑中只装有普通的网卡,就选择普通网卡的ISO的通讯方式,如下图:本实验中选择的是Broadcom的普通以太网卡连接作为PG/PC物理通讯接口。


图9 设置PG/PC接口参数

完成PG/PC接口的设置,重新回到HW Config编辑器的界面,保存并编译硬件项目

1.CPU——是plc的核心部分

与通用微机CPU一样,CPU在PC系统中的作用类似于人体的神经中枢。其功能:

  (1)用扫描方式(后面介绍)接收现场输入装置的状态或数据,并存入输入映象寄存器或数据寄存器;

  (2)接收并存储从编程器输入的用户程序和数据;

  (3)诊断电源和PC内部电路的工作状态及编程过程中的语法错误;

  (4)在PC进入运行状态后:

  a)执行用户程序——产生相应的控制信号(从用户程序存储器中逐条读取指令,经命令解释后,按指令规定的任务产生相应的控制信号,去启闭有关的控制电路)

  b)进行数据处理——分时、分渠道地执行数据存取、传送、组合、比较、变换等动作,完成用户程序中规定的逻辑或算术运算任务

  c)更新输出状态——输出实施控制(根据运算结果,更新有关标志位的状态和输出映象寄存器的内容,再由输入映象寄存器或数据寄存器的内容,实现输出控制、制表、打印、数据通讯等)

  2.存储器

  系统程序存储器——存放系统工作程序(监控程序)、模块化应用功能子程序、命令

  解释、功能子程序的调用管理程序和系统参数

  *不能由用户直接存取

  用户存储器用户程序存储器——存放用户程序。即用户通过编程器输入的用户程序。

  功能存储器(数据区)——存放用户数据

  PC的用户存储器通常以字(16位/字)为单位来表示存储容量。

  注意:系统程序直接关系到PC的性能,不能由用户直接存取,所以,通常PC产品资料中所指的存储器形式或存储方式及容量,是指用户程序存储器而言。

  3.I/O(输入/输出部件)

  CPU与现场I/O装置或其他外部设备之间的连接部件。PLC提供了各种操作电平与驱动能力的I/O模块,以及各种用途的I/O组件供用户选用:

  输入/输出电平转换

  电气隔离

  串/并行转换

  数据传送

  A/D、D/A转换

  误码校验

  其他功能模块

  I/O模块可与CPU放在一起,也可远程放置。通常,I/O模块上还具有状态显示和I/O接线端子排。

  4.编程器等外部设备

  编程器——PLC开发应用、监测运行、检查维护不可缺少的工具

  作用:用于用户程序的编制、编辑、调试、检查和监视

  通过键盘和显示器去检测PLC内部状态和参数

  通过通讯端口与CPU联系,实现与PLC的人机对话

  分类:简单型——只能联机编程;只能用指令清单编程

  智能型——既可联机(Online),也可脱机(Offline)编程;可以采用指令清单(语句表)、梯形图等语言编程。常可直接以电脑作为编程器,安装相关的编程软件编程

  注意:编程器不直接加入现场控制运行。一台编程器可开发、监护许多台PLC的工作。

  其他外设:磁盘、光盘、EPROM写入器(用于固化用户程序)、打印机、图形监视系统或上位计算机等等。

  5.电源

  内部——开关稳压电源,供内部电路使用;大多数机型还可以向外提供DC24V稳压电源,为现场的开关信号、外部传感器供电。

  外部——可用一般工业电源,并备有锂电池(备用电池),使外部电源故障时内部重要数据不致丢失。


联系方式

  • 地址:上海松江 上海市松江区石湖荡镇塔汇路755弄29号1幢一层A区213室
  • 邮编:201600
  • 联系电话:未提供
  • 经理:聂航
  • 手机:15221406036
  • 微信:15221406036
  • QQ:3064686604
  • Email:3064686604@qq.com